This 23.8-inch FHD All-in-One with an Intel N100 CPU and 16GB RAM is for basic productivity, web browsing, and streaming, not demanding tasks.
This AIO is a situational fit because its Intel N100 processor and 16GB RAM are perfectly adequate for basic office tasks and web browsing, but its integrated graphics and entry-level CPU limit its utility for anything beyond that. The 23.8-inch FHD IPS display with 99% sRGB is a strong point for visual clarity in its intended use cases.
If you need more processing power for light creative work or more demanding applications, look for an AIO with an Intel Core i3 or i5 processor.

Pros
- The 23.8-inch FHD IPS anti-glare display covers 99% sRGB, making text crisp and images natural for extended daily use.
- Its all-in-one design integrates the monitor and computer into a single slim unit, reducing desk clutter and cable mess.
- Wi-Fi 6 and Bluetooth 5.2 provide fast, stable wireless connections, especially in busy environments.
- Includes 2x USB 2.0, 2x USB 3.2 Gen 2, HDMI-out 1.4b, and Ethernet for connecting multiple peripherals and a second display.
- Runs cool and makes very little noise, allowing for focused work without distraction.
- The 16GB DDR4 RAM prevents slowdowns when multitasking with web browsing, video conferencing, and document editing.
Cons
- The Intel N100 processor is not designed for heavy gaming or professional-grade content creation.
- The stand only offers tilt adjustment (-5° to 25°), lacking height adjustment for optimal ergonomics.
- The internal 256GB SSD might feel restrictive for users with large local file libraries, despite the included 512GB external storage.
- The included wireless keyboard and mouse are described as simple and functional, not premium peripherals.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I upgrade the RAM or storage?
The product features 16GB DDR4 RAM and a 256GB internal SSD, but the feature highlights mention support for up to 32GB RAM and 1TB NVMe M.2 SSD, suggesting potential for user upgrades.
Is the display a touchscreen?
No, the 23.8-inch FHD (1920x1080) IPS display is non-touch.
Does it come with a webcam?
Yes, it has a built-in HD camera and a mono microphone, suitable for video conferencing.
What kind of ports does it have?
It includes 2x USB 2.0, 2x USB 3.2 Gen 2, 1x HDMI-out 1.4b, 1x Ethernet (RJ-45), and a headphone/microphone combo jack.

Buying Guide
When you're looking at an all-in-one desktop, you're trading some upgradeability for a clean, compact setup. Think about what you'll actually use it for daily. The processor and RAM determine how many apps you can run smoothly, while the display quality impacts your comfort during long sessions. Don't get caught up in raw power if you just need it for everyday tasks.
Intel N100 Processor
This is like the efficient, small engine in a commuter car. It's built for fuel economy (low power consumption) and getting you around town (basic tasks) reliably, but it won't win any drag races (heavy gaming or video editing).
16GB DDR4 RAM
Think of RAM as your computer's short-term memory or workspace. 16GB is like having a spacious desk; you can have many documents (browser tabs, applications) open simultaneously without things feeling cramped or slowing down.
23.8" FHD IPS Anti-glare Display (99% sRGB)
This is your window to the digital world. FHD (1920x1080) means clear images, IPS means colors look consistent from different angles, anti-glare reduces reflections, and 99% sRGB means colors are accurate and vibrant, like a good quality photo print.
Wi-Fi 6 & Bluetooth 5.2
These are your wireless connections. Wi-Fi 6 is like a wider, less congested highway for your internet, meaning faster and more stable connections. Bluetooth 5.2 is for connecting wireless headphones, keyboards, or mice with less lag and more reliability.
